When viewing the camera either locally on the same WiFi or remotely the app displays the connection as either of the following: 

 

Local

P2P

Relay

 

What is the difference between the two and if one is displayed instead of the other does that mean the connection isn't as good as it could be etc?

The Local/P2P/Relay are three different patterns for clients to obtain video streams from the camera side. Local means the client streams the camera in the local network, Relay means the client streams the camera via the cloud server, and P2P means the client streams the camera via P2P penetration. 
The pattern of the client stream camera is determined by the network environment and specific usage conditions. Generally, the client will choose the best way to watch the camera automatically.
